Oakland police say two people were injured by gunfire not far from the Fruitvale BART station Sunday evening.
OAKLAND -- Two people were shot near the Fruitvale BART station in Oakland on Sunday evening, briefly halting trains from stopping in the area.
Police say they received calls of a person shot just before 5:15 p.m. in the 3300 block of E 12th Street.The Oakland Fire Department and Falck Ambulance personnel arrived and transported the victims were transported to a local hospital. Their conditions were unknown as of 7:20 p.m. Police say anyone with information about the shootings can call OPD's felony assault unit at 238-3426.
